The annual Gala Innocent, Innocent, a televised event raising funds for children’s health, is set to air live this Sunday, December 28, at 10:00 p.m.(peninsular time) on La 1 de TVE and RTVE Play.

The Day of the Holy Innocents offers a captivating look at how traditions morph over time. Originally a day of grief reflecting on the tragedy of children lost in Herod’s time, it’s now widely recognized as a day for humor, laughter, and harmless pranks. This evolution demonstrates how cultural practices adapt to modern realities, allowing people to find joy and connection even through absurdity.

Today, the holiday is marked by a blend of local customs, playful tricks, and humorous events. People across many countries participate in “innocent” pranks-ranging from playful phone calls with fabricated news to surprising friends and coworkers. even the media gets in on the fun, often publishing fake news stories or humorous reports designed to elicit a laugh.

This year marks the 30th edition of gala Innocent,Innocent,and proceeds will support the fight against childhood cancer,funding vital research projects and medical treatments.Presenters Paula Vázquez, Juanma Iturriaga, Jacob Petrus, and Carolina Casado will orchestrate pranks on a lineup of well-known faces, including soccer player Santi Cazorla, actress Itziar Miranda, presenter aitor Albizua, singer Leire Martínez, and actress Nadia de Santiago.
